Output 31a984e2fa4ef01ebee88d0457192bfc00a41548ccb00ded3e81e3c4b58d6317:0

value
16275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57cc990af558d6e6f60bae3c131a758375c9c1b8 OP_EQUAL
address
39hFowR2N1qEuL11juLS5mQxznhmrsprqF
transaction
31a984e2fa4ef01ebee88d0457192bfc00a41548ccb00ded3e81e3c4b58d6317
spent
true